# Illinois SB 3189 (93rd) — VEH CD-9/11 LICENSE PLATES
Amends the Illinois Vehicle Code to authorize the Director of the Illinois Emergency Management Agency (rather than Commerce and Economic Opportunity) to make grants of moneys from the September 11th Fund. Effective immediately.
